SUMMARY:
Namify’s Laser Machine Operator position will be responsible for the workflow of orders to Quality Control Processors. Ensuring all orders are produced and sent to clients on time. The Machine Operator will need to be a problem solver to assist our clients. This position is hands on with long periods of standing.
JOB RESPONSIBILIES:
- Operate laser engraving machines to maximum efficiency
- Hit labor standards while producing quality goods for our clients
- Communicate with other departments to ensure information is consistent
- Follow sales orders to ensure products are made properly
- Read and understand order flows
- Monitor machines for problems and troubleshoot problems
- Check raw materials for quality before processing
- Prepare raw materials to be loaded into the machine
- Prepare tooling for changeovers and perform machine changeovers
- Follow production instructions to ensure quality
- Carry out basic calculations with aid of a computer and calculator
- Follow written instructions and batch records
- Maintain quality and quantity with strong sense of accountability and high standards
- Complete relevant documentation
- Clean and maintain equipment and work area
- All other duties as assigned

WORK SPACE INFO:
This job operates in a warehouse environment which requires standing, moving, lifting, and operating machinery and computers. Personal Protection Equipment may be required. Safety training is mandatory and employees must be able to pass basic safety requirements.
TRAINING:
Training for this position will be completed by the department manager. Training will consist of education on key processes, preparation and staging requirements by customer, location of tools, supplies and materials. You will be trained on how to use the order interface, how to properly read orders and where to look for notes. Additional training will be completed as processes evolve or as required.
